Fiery Cajun Shrimp Stuffed Jalapeños

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 12 servings
  • Category: Appetizer
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: Cajun
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

Description

Deliciously spicy jalapeños filled with creamy Cajun shrimp for a flavorful appetizer.


Ingredients

  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up cooked shrimp (finely chopped)
  • 1 tsp Cajun se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1/4 tsp salt (adjust to taste)
  • 1/4 cup breadcrumbs (optional)
  • 2 tbsp melted butter (optional)
  • 12 large jalapeños (halved and seeds removed)
  • Fresh parsley or green onions (for garnish)


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Combine cream cheese, cheddar cheese, shrimp, Cajun seasoning, garlic powder, smoked paprika, and salt in a bowl. Mix until smooth.
  3. Fill jalapeño halves with the mixture and smooth the tops with a spatula.
  4. Mix breadcrumbs with melted butter, then sprinkle on top of the stuffed jalapeños (optional).
  5. Bake for 15-20 minutes or until bubbly and golden on top.
  6. Garnish with freshly chopped parsley or green onions and serve warm.

Notes

For extra flavor, consider marinating the shrimp in Cajun seasoning before mixing. Serve with a cooling dip if desired.
